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
50 commits
Select commit Hold shift + click to select a range
4bffc46
test fix
ZemindJan Feb 7, 2025
5f67b38
Blueprint support
ZemindJan Feb 12, 2025
2be835f
All method implementations for Checkout done again in a working and m…
azevedco Feb 10, 2025
3026e1d
ReAdded GetCheckoutOptions methods
azevedco Feb 10, 2025
288ed1f
Small update for test checkout scripts to resolve build errors
azevedco Feb 13, 2025
f90e4f5
All Checkout functions have been made to support Blueprints
azevedco Feb 14, 2025
8aa106f
All Checkout relevant systems and structs now available via Blueprints
azevedco Feb 14, 2025
3fdf046
Checkout is now accessible through subsystem, removed dependency of a…
azevedco Feb 26, 2025
cdcb211
Merging 228-marketplace-reader for ListCurrencies access
azevedco Mar 6, 2025
332c564
Switched project version to 5.5
azevedco Mar 6, 2025
018c504
Resolved issues around preparing data for post and handling data sent…
azevedco Mar 18, 2025
ebd4f5e
Added remaining functions to be invoked from blueprints in SequenceCh…
azevedco Mar 19, 2025
849ec17
Renamed Checkout to SequenceCheckout. Moved the SequenceCheckout hea…
azevedco Mar 25, 2025
2667fdb
Fixed an issue of incorrect data being managed when converting steps …
azevedco Mar 26, 2025
3ec44b5
Updated SignInOutRepeatedlyTest such that it verifies that the sessio…
BellringerQuinn Oct 17, 2024
88a888d
First Commit for validation
caballoninja Oct 10, 2024
d28bbbb
Added VerifySignature
caballoninja Oct 16, 2024
28135d3
Futher Validator checks
caballoninja Oct 22, 2024
4067f83
Parameters fix
caballoninja Jan 13, 2025
ab419bb
Added Etherlink mainnet and testnet and XR1 mainnet
BellringerQuinn Feb 14, 2025
cae63e9
beginning sardine
ZemindJan Mar 10, 2025
015bed2
More data types
ZemindJan Mar 10, 2025
4114d4f
Update SardineCheckout.h
ZemindJan Mar 10, 2025
8740dc6
sardine regions
ZemindJan Mar 10, 2025
f9d27f7
better signature
ZemindJan Mar 10, 2025
95d8ddf
full api
ZemindJan Mar 10, 2025
047e5cd
sardine quote
ZemindJan Mar 13, 2025
0c8a952
sardine progress, need marketplace stuff
ZemindJan Mar 17, 2025
8565e7e
Added get collectible to marketplace
ZemindJan Mar 17, 2025
3c43895
get enabled tokens response
ZemindJan Mar 17, 2025
a8f8f3b
more sardine api filled out
ZemindJan Mar 17, 2025
9c51818
ik/fixing build errors after rebasing marketplace checkout branch
inha-kim Mar 27, 2025
afe7f2d
Updated SignInOutRepeatedlyTest such that it verifies that the sessio…
BellringerQuinn Oct 17, 2024
7b13c60
Futher Validator checks
caballoninja Oct 22, 2024
94368fc
Added get collectible to marketplace
ZemindJan Mar 17, 2025
5917aba
First Commit for validation
caballoninja Oct 10, 2024
4f6ec3a
Implementing endpoints for ticket #287
inha-kim Mar 19, 2025
97cfc3c
ik/Adding test cases for no arg calls; modifying data types to accoun…
inha-kim Mar 21, 2025
f59a162
ik/Adding on ramp url for client tokens
inha-kim Mar 24, 2025
b00d818
ik/Post-merge conflicts fix and implementing missing endpoints
inha-kim Mar 24, 2025
3ba1d85
ik/removing unnecessary files
inha-kim Mar 24, 2025
787b499
ik/Fixing index out of bounds exception when encoding empty dynamic data
inha-kim Apr 1, 2025
276ee82
ik/implementing ERC1155 endpoint with mock data
inha-kim Apr 1, 2025
a711781
ik/Adding payment details eth call instead of mock data
inha-kim Apr 3, 2025
a1f1544
ik/finalizing ER721 endpoint; implementing test; some code cleanup
inha-kim Apr 8, 2025
9fdd076
Checkout implemenation
ZemindJan Apr 4, 2025
8fc0cb1
checkout nearly finished
ZemindJan Apr 7, 2025
9b72872
blueprinting start
ZemindJan Apr 8, 2025
8881194
blueprints
ZemindJan Apr 8, 2025
6edb3af
Merge pull request #308 from 0xsequence/jd/sardine_checkout
inha-kim Apr 8, 2025
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 3 additions & 1 deletion .vsconfig
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,11 @@
"version": "1.0",
"components": [
"Microsoft.Net.Component.4.6.2.TargetingPack",
"Microsoft.VisualStudio.Component.Unreal.Workspace",
"Microsoft.VisualStudio.Component.VC.14.38.17.8.ATL",
"Microsoft.VisualStudio.Component.VC.14.38.17.8.x86.x64",
"Microsoft.VisualStudio.Component.VC.Tools.x86.x64",
"Microsoft.VisualStudio.Component.Windows10SDK.22621",
"Microsoft.VisualStudio.Component.Windows11SDK.22621",
"Microsoft.VisualStudio.Workload.CoreEditor",
"Microsoft.VisualStudio.Workload.ManagedDesktop",
"Microsoft.VisualStudio.Workload.NativeDesktop",
Expand Down
4 changes: 2 additions & 2 deletions Config/SequenceConfig.ini
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
[/Script/Sequence.Config]
FallbackEncryptionKey = "aaaabbbbccccddddaaaabbbbccccdddd"
WaaSConfigKey = "eyJwcm9qZWN0SWQiOjM3MDY2LCJycGNTZXJ2ZXIiOiJodHRwczovL3dhYXMuc2VxdWVuY2UuYXBwIn0="
ProjectAccessKey = "AQAAAAAAAJDKR9cs25gJSSKzszRT9STo9hk"
WaaSConfigKey = "eyJwcm9qZWN0SWQiOjQxMDg3LCJycGNTZXJ2ZXIiOiJodHRwczovL3dhYXMuc2VxdWVuY2UuYXBwIn0="
ProjectAccessKey = "AQAAAAAAAKB_eaItDuiSDnsDrg1TM5Izj_k"
GoogleClientID = "970987756660-35a6tc48hvi8cev9cnknp0iugv9poa23.apps.googleusercontent.com"
AppleClientID = "com.horizon.sequence.waas"
FacebookClientID = ""
Expand Down
3 changes: 3 additions & 0 deletions Plugins/SequencePlugin/Config/DefaultSequencePlugin.ini
Original file line number Diff line number Diff line change
@@ -0,0 +1,3 @@
[CoreRedirects]
+FunctionRedirects=(OldName="/Script/SequencePlugin.SequenceMarketplaceBP.GetCollectiblesWithLowestListingsAsync",NewName="/Script/SequencePlugin.SequenceMarketplaceBP.GetCollectiblesWithLowestListingsFirstAsync")
+FunctionRedirects=(OldName="/Script/SequencePlugin.SequenceMarketplaceBP.GetCollectiblesWithHighestListingsFirstAsync",NewName="/Script/SequencePlugin.SequenceMarketplaceBP.GetCollectiblesWithHighestPricedOffersFirstAsync")
Git LFS file not shown
Git LFS file not shown
Git LFS file not shown
Original file line number Diff line number Diff line change
Expand Up @@ -345,6 +345,11 @@ void TDynamicABIData::EncodeTail(TArray<uint8> &Data, int HeadPosition, int Offs
PushEmptyBlock(Data);
CopyInUInt32(Data, MyData.Num(), BlockPos);

if (MyData.IsEmpty())
{
return;
}

// Encode Data
uint32 BlockLen = (MyData.Num() + GBlockByteLength - 1) / GBlockByteLength;
Data.Append(&MyData[0], MyData.Num());
Expand Down
Loading